GHD is currently seeking applications for Cadet Documentation Technicians to join our business. In this role, under direct supervision, you will learn drafting and design skills across a wide variety of industry sectors and will become competent using the relevant software, appropriate to your chosen discipline / industry sector. Dependent on your discipline and team the software may range from AutoCAD, Revit, 12d, Plant3d, Advance Steel, Inventor or Solidworks.

Key responsibilities of these positions include:

  • Assisting in the preparation of drawings using AutoCAD and or other 3D design/drafting software in the field of engineering. Projects range from, buildings, energy and resources, transport and urban development, water, and mining infrastructure.
  • Collaborating with senior team members on various technical tasks and taking guidance in support of your role
  • Developing your knowledge of GHD's Digital Design Manual and other relevant systems, tools, and processes
  • Developing your knowledge of BIM (Building Information Modelling)
  • Attending TAFE or University and maintaining requirements of a Traineeship or Cadetship, which will include a combination of work-based training and formal training.

What you will bring to the role:

  • QCE (or equivalent) completion with strong academic results in Mathematics and English
  • Experience in AutoCAD desirable but not essential
  • Strong desire to build a rewarding career as a professional drafter/designer
  • Well-developed communication skills and a proven attention to detail
  • Intermediate computer skills coupled with a positive attitude and a desire to learn
  • Genuine interest in technical drawing and engineering

We are passionate about the development of our Cadet Documentation Technicians and on our structured Cadet Development Program you will learn about our business, our values, your team and most importantly, yourself. You will develop your decision-making, communication and technical skills, access personal mentoring, and participate in a variety of development activities. You will also gain invaluable on-the-job experience and create networks that will last a lifetime.

GHD will fund your course costs and you will be given study allowance time to attend your lectures, exams, and complete assignments. You will be employed on a full-time basis with access to all employee’s staff benefits.
